Restaurant of the Week: Barrel House
Barrel House, located in the heart of Downtown Cedar Rapids, is only a few blocks from all the major theaters and entertainment venues in the city, including TCR, McGrath Amphitheatre, the Paramount and the Alliant Energy Powerhouse. Barrel House is an upscale tavern pub that has a little something for everyone, including 16 beers on tap and daily specials.

Restaurant of the Week: Textile TapHaus
Residents of Atkins and surrounding Iowa communities have a new local restaurant to enjoy: Textile TapHaus. Textile TapHaus opened May 2 and is the third installment under the Textile brand, after Textile Brewing Company in Dyersville and The Corner Taproom in Cascade.
